Introducing Lotus Hot Spring

Lotus Hot Spring is located 5 kilometers from Lotus Township, 28 kilometers from Lianghe in Tengchong County, Baoshan City, Yunnan Province. Lotus Hot Spring is a comprehensive service area and tourist attraction integrating vacation and leisure, health and recuperation, sightseeing, exhibition and shopping, catering and accommodation, conference reception, business negotiations, and cultural exchanges.

The park fully utilizes its unique hot spring resources and natural ecological and pastoral scenery, offering a wide range of services through high-end planning and meticulous design. The area boasts a variety of high-quality mineral springs, including sulfur springs, kaolin springs, carbonate springs, and sodium chloride springs. These springs are abundant and rich in trace elements beneficial to the human body, offering special therapeutic benefits for healing, health, and skin beautification.

The resort, covering over 300 mu (approximately 1,000 acres), is an international boutique resort hotel with 180 rooms, eight conference rooms, Chinese and Western restaurants, and a forest hot spring area. The resort also offers 25 outdoor forest hot spring pools and 20 high-end resort suites with executive butlers, including beauty, gourmet food, physiotherapy, massage, and pedicure services.

Climate and best time to travel

With a subtropical valley climate, located at an altitude of 1,640 meters, the annual average temperature is 18°C, with neither severe cold in winter nor scorching heat in summer. Rainfall is plentiful year-round, and the weather is mild and humid, making it suitable for travel in all seasons.

The Lotus Hot Spring Forest Spa is a rare type of hot spring that has reached the level of "hot spring soup" - kaolin hot spring. Its main component is volcanic mud. Because it contains a large amount of trace elements that are beneficial to the human body, such as promoting blood circulation, whitening, and repairing sensitive skin, the soup sometimes looks milky white.

Lotus Hot Springs is located at Fenshui Pass, one of the ancient passes along the southern route traveled by the great traveler Xu Xiake: Zhenyi Pass, Bajiao Pass, Fenshui Pass, Nangsong Pass, Tongbi Pass, and Wanren Pass. Fenshui Pass marked the boundary between the north and south temperature differences in Tengchong, and served as the national gateway for the Tengchong section of the Southern Silk Road. The area still retains the ancient Southern Silk Road caravan routes, and legends of those who traveled extensively and returned with bountiful harvests still linger: "Shang Qicuo, Xia Qicuo, gold is buried in Qiqicuo; whoever digs for it could buy a Tengyue Prefecture..."
